I don't like 'Titanic'. I find it far too melodramatic, awfully flat in terms of characterization (with an obviously Manichean portrayal of the characters), and telling a very simplistic story -although the way it's told is undeniably elegant-.
However, Cameron's super production has an epic aspect and a popular status which forbids me not to recognize in it any virtues, one of these being the way the film shed light on the 1912 human catastrophe, another one its tear-jerking ability.
